Common mistakes and fixes
| Mistake | Fix |
|---|---|
| Assuming desktop software bypasses provider rules | MailFleet manages campaigns through your providers; their policies still apply. |
| Changing multiple variables at once | Change one factor per test so results are attributable. |
| Skipping test sends and log review | Send a small batch first; inspect bounces and deferrals in MailFleet logs. |
| Using purchased or scraped lists | Send only to permission-based contacts with documented opt-in and working suppressions. |
| Ignoring provider rate limits and quotas | Use capacity scoring and throttling; split work across approved profiles if needed. |

Can any tool guarantee inbox placement for SPF DKIM DMARC Header Results?
No. Placement depends on reputation, authentication, content, engagement, and mailbox filters. MailFleet helps IT teams prepare responsibly and inspect results — it does not claim guaranteed delivery.

Which failure signals matter most for SPF DKIM DMARC Header Results (2477)?
Watch authentication failures, hard bounces, deferrals clustered by provider, and sudden SpamAssassin or content-filter spikes. Those signals usually beat vague “inbox” anecdotes for IT teams.
